Climate observation satellite Shikisai captured tanegashima island and chlorophyll-a concentration.
This image depicts chlorophyll-a concentration in the ocean: Pink areas indicate higher concentrations, while yellow areas represent lower concentrations. Tanegashima, home to a rocket launch site, is centrally located, with Yakushima, a World Heritage Site, visible to the southwest.
Observation date: July 31st, 2024
Observation area: Japan, Tanegashima island
Observation satellite: Global Change Observation Mission - Climate "SHIKISAI" (GCOM-C)
